Gator Machete, Gator Grip Handle, Nylon Sheath - Gator Machete

Features a 15 in. black oxide coated steel blade and a 10 in. Gator grip handle. Comes complete with a reinforced nylon sheath.

5Needs Field Test  Apr 07, 2008
The Gerber "Gator" appears to be a good machete, but I've not yet had the chance to field test it. The handle is well-designed and comfortable. I like it better than other machete handles I've used because it is soft on the surface and hard as iron underneath. It is also ergonomically friendly; it fits into my hand's natural contours nicely.
I haven't yet decided weather I like the ridge back. I suppose it depends on how much I hurt myself with it this summer. One other minor con for the sawback is that they make drawing and putting away more difficult. On the plus side, it should be excellent for mowing through harder and thicker brush. I feel a little dubious about it's use as an actual saw, but it might work.
I do wish Gerber would post what kind of steel they used so I know I'm not getting suckered with some pansy, high-chromium junk that's better suited for the rims on a Lexus.
The price is excellent; even with shipping, it was only about $25.00. Gerber generally makes quality products, so I am giving this machete the benefit of the doubt for now. I'll write another review in August with the real story.
